Ferroalloy plant set up in Terjola

Hundred people will be employed in the new ferroalloy enterprise, which will be created in Terjola municipality within the "Enterprise Georgia" program framework. According to the Ministry of Economy, 61,506 square meters of non-agricultural land was transferred from the state to the company "Manganese Industry" for a symbolic price - one GEL. The Government decided to support the project within the program at the initiative of the Ministry of Economy.

The company has to establish the enterprise within a maximum of two years and invest at least GEL 1 722 000.

The project envisages the creation of two ferrosilicon manganese lines with a total production capacity of 16,000 tons per year.

According to the company, the products produced will be mainly intended for export markets, which will provide millions of dollars of inflow into the country. According to them, the launch of production and increase in exports of products will positively impact the country's main economic variables, such as exchange rate, employment, increase in labor productivity, technological progress, etc.

The state program "Enterprise Georgia" has been working for several years, and hundreds of new enterprises are being created or expanded throughout Georgia. Today, thousands of new jobs have been created with the program's support, industrial and property transfer, hotel business, or micro and small entrepreneurship components, and this process continues despite the pandemic.
